Photos: Troops burst kidnapping syndicate in Ohafia, Abia State,


operation aimed and bursting a notorious
kidnapping syndicate based in Nkporo
community of Ohafia Local Government Area of
Abia State.
According to the statement issued today by
Colonel Sani Kukasheka Usman
Acting Director Army Public Relations, during the
operation, the troops were able to rescued a
kidnap victim who was earlier shot and
kidnapped by his abductors at Aba on 6th April
2016. However one of the suspected kidnappers
Mr Chidiebere Sunday was apprehended while 2
of his suspected accomplices escaped. One
other member of the gang in a bid to evade
arrest through the roof of their den fell from a
roof, hit his head on the hard floor and died.
The troops recovered the following items from
the kidnappers; 2 AK-47 rifles, 9 AK-47 rifle
magazine loaded with 124 rounds of 7.62mm
Special ammunition, 1 Pistol, 2 rounds of 9mm
ammunition, 2 machetes and the sum of Five
Million, Four Hundred and Ninety Thousand Naira
(N5,490,000.00) only.
Other items recovered include a Toyota RAV4
jeep with registration number MUS 428 RZ,
military camouflage jungle hat, 6 mobile
telephone handsets, an iPad, Diamond Bank
Debit Card, bunch of different keys, 2 empty
bags and a wrap of suspected marijuana.
